开通会员
  • 尊享所有功能
  • 文件大小最高200M
  • 文件无水印
  • 尊贵VIP身份
  • VIP专属服务
  • 历史记录保存30天云存储
开通会员
您的位置:首页 > 帮助中心 > java生成pdf设置每页标题_Java实现PDF每页添加标题的技巧
默认会员免费送
帮助中心 >

java生成pdf设置每页标题_Java实现PDF每页添加标题的技巧

2024-12-27 01:03:12
java生成pdf设置每页标题_java实现pdf每页添加标题的技巧
《java生成pdf设置每页标题》

在java中,可利用一些库(如itext等)来生成pdf并设置每页标题。首先,引入相关库到项目中。使用itext时,创建document对象表示pdf文档。

要设置每页标题,可通过添加页眉的方式实现。定义一个paragraph对象来包含标题内容。在创建pdf页面事件时,将这个paragraph添加到页面的页眉区域。在页事件的onendpage方法中,确定页眉的位置等样式属性。这样,当生成pdf的每一页时,都会在指定位置显示设定好的标题。这有助于提高pdf的可读性和规范性,尤其在生成多页文档时,每页的标题能明确标识页面内容的主题或者所属部分。

javapdf模板生成pdf

javapdf模板生成pdf
《使用java pdf模板生成pdf》

在java开发中,利用pdf模板生成pdf文件是一种高效的方式。首先,需要选择合适的java pdf库,例如itext等。

借助pdf模板,可以预先定义好文档的布局结构,如页面大小、页眉页脚样式、表格框架等。在java代码中,通过读取模板文件,然后将数据填充到模板的相应位置。对于动态数据,如从数据库查询得到的记录,可按照模板中的字段标识进行精准替换。这样一来,既保证了pdf文档格式的一致性,又能快速生成大量格式统一但内容不同的pdf文件。无论是生成报表、电子票据还是合同文档等,java基于pdf模板生成pdf的方法都能极大地提高开发效率,满足多样化的业务需求。

java pdf生成工具

java pdf生成工具
《java中的pdf生成工具》

在java开发中,有多种实用的pdf生成工具。其中,itext是一款广为人知的库。

itext提供了丰富的功能来创建pdf文档。它允许开发者以编程的方式构建pdf的结构,包括添加文本、表格、图像等元素。通过简单的java代码,就可以设置字体、字号、颜色等文本属性,精准地控制内容的排版。例如,在生成报表pdf时,可以方便地循环数据添加表格行。

另外,apache pdfbox也是一个不错的选择。它同样能够实现pdf的创建、编辑以及文本提取等操作。这些工具在企业级应用中,如电子文档生成、发票打印等场景发挥着重要作用,极大地提高了开发效率并满足了各种pdf相关的业务需求。

java生成pdf工具类

java生成pdf工具类
# java生成pdf工具类

在java开发中,生成pdf文件是一项常见需求。一个实用的java生成pdf工具类能大大提高效率。

首先,需要引入相关的pdf库,如itext等。工具类中的核心方法可以包括创建pdf文档对象,设置页面大小、边距等基本属性。例如:

```java
import com.itextpdf.text.document;
import com.itextpdf.text.documentexception;
import com.itextpdf.text.pdf.pdfwriter;

public class pdfgenerator {
public static document createdocument() throws documentexception {
document document = new document();
pdfwriter.getinstance(document, new fileoutputstream("output.pdf"));
document.open();
return document;
}
}
```

这个简单的工具类方法只是开始,还可以添加向文档添加文本、图像、表格等元素的方法,以便构建完整的pdf内容,满足不同的业务场景需求。
您已连续签到 0 天,当前积分:0
  • 第1天
    积分+10
  • 第2天
    积分+10
  • 第3天
    积分+10
  • 第4天
    积分+10
  • 第5天
    积分+10
  • 第6天
    积分+10
  • 第7天

    连续签到7天

    获得积分+10

获得10积分

明天签到可得10积分

咨询客服

扫描二维码,添加客服微信